
The village of Hayward serves as the primary hub in this early 1980s landscape of southern Minnesota, where the agrarian grid is defined by an extensive drainage network including Judicial Ditch No 12 and Turtle Creek. The area’s spiritual and communal history is well-preserved through several rural landmarks, such as Moscow Ch and Oakland Ch, alongside numerous burial grounds like St Pauls Cem and the Seventh-day Adventist Cem.
